There are a few notes to take before beginning your conquest Each contestant is given nothing but a sword, the ability to sprint, and their wits. weapons and ammo are scarce. use them wisely. The contestants spawn in an atrium lobby. At this time, no damage can be done to anyone, and this is the place where players can decide whether or not they want to form an alliance with someone else, or just to watch other players. After the clock counts down, the players will be teleported to the games. There is an old, crashed aircraft that holds the majority of the weapons. weapons here spawn over time, so keep your eyes peeled here, but beware, dont just rush in to get a gun at first, you might get killed this way. There are no radars or waypoints, you have to track people down and use your binoculars to find your targets. Stay quiet (minimum sprinting) and stay low (stay in cover) There are no shields and health does not regenerate. Health packs are few, but can be found. The thing about Hunger Games themed maps (you can't deny it is not Hunger Game themed) is that it is a pain the ass when there is only 3 people left, and with a huge map like this, you will not be seeing much action. The people who are dead will also be extremely bored as these games tend to go on fore or until someone cracks and decides to just run and jump around. As people will not want to die and suffer the misery of the death camera, they will just camp, making for slow flow and no action.
